Japanese Grant Aid for Human Resource Development Scholarship (JDS), Mongolia 2011-2012
Japanese Grant Aid for Human Resource Development Scholarship (JDS) 2011-2012 for government officials in Mongolia.
Objective:
Japanese Grant Aid for Human Resource Development Scholarship (JDS) was established by the Government of Mongolia with the assistance of the Government of Japan for the Japanese fiscal year of 2001.
The objective of JDS Program is to support human resources development of Mongolia that receive Japanese grant aid, targeting highly capable, young government officials who are expected to engage in formulating and implementing social and economic development plans and to become leaders in Mongolia. Participants of the JDS Program shall contribute to an expanded and enhanced foundation for bilateral relations with Japan, as persons having well-rounded knowledge of Japan.
Participants of the JDS program will acquire expert knowledge, conduct research, and build human networks at Japanese universities, and are expected to use such knowledge to take an active role in practically solving problems of the social and economic development issues that Mongolia is facing.
2. Framework of JDS Program in Mongolia:
The framework of the JDS program under new system was applied in JFY 2008, in order to ensure the better assessment and enhance efficiencies of the program. A single program was designed to have “four batches” and this is the third batch in Mongolia.
The new JDS program consists of the sectors called “sub-program” and “component”, which correspond to and deal with the selected target priority area and development issues. In Mongolia, three sub-programs and seven components have been settled, which were confirmed as being indispensable to the economic and social development of Mongolia through the preliminary study. The candidates of the JDS program are selected from the “Target Organizations” related to the target priority areas and development issues to be developed. Accepting Japanese universities are allocated to each component, which provide educational programs corresponded to the needs on development issues. The degree to be obtained is master’s degree (2 years course). The number of dispatches is 18 for one batch. The Medium of instruction is English.
3. Qualification to applyTarget government organizations were set under JDS program in Mongolia. Therefore, the component and the university that you will study in are decided due to the organization which you belong to.
Other qualifications are as followings;
(1) Citizen of Mongolia
(2) Between the age of 22 and 39 as of April 1, 2011
(3) Must be a regular employee who has more than two-years work experience in the target organization.
(Please refer ‘Framework of JDS Program of Mongolia’ of “Application’s Guideline”)
(4) Has a bachelor’s degree from universities authorized by the Government of Mongolia or other countries.
(5) Has a Basic Mathematics skill except Kyushu University
(6) Has a good command of both written and spoken English.(TOEFL score of 500 or higher is preferred)
(7) Mentally and physically in good health.
(8) Has not been awarded or scheduled to receive another scholarship.
(9) Has not already taken a master’s degree in a foreign country under any kind of scholarship.
(10) Military personnel registered on the active list or person on alternative military service can not apply for JDS.
Please refer the’ Qualifications and Requirements of Participants’ of “Application Guideline in detail.
